About the Job
The senior process engineer assumes accountability for Pyro [1] process, comminution, classification, hydration, and/or precipitation across all production units utilizing that technology. The senior process engineer establishes themselves as the resident expert in this technology, both in its current and future utilization.
Requirements
Required BS in Engineering or related field with preference for advanced degree in Engineering.
10+ years of process and operations management experience

About Mississippi Lime Company
Mississippi Lime Company (“MLC”), headquartered in St. Louis, Mo., is a leading global supplier of high-calcium lime products and technical solutions. These offerings bring essential performance and value to a broad range of market applications, including metals, construction, chemical synthesis, water and emissions treatment, glass, textiles, plastics, rubber, agriculture, foods and beverages. With over a century in business, MLC has built a reputation on the quality of its products and services, as well as an unwavering commitment to safety, sustainability and service. The company’s expanding global footprint includes a diversified, reliable network of production and distribution facilities in the U.S., as well as in the UK through our Singleton Birch business.
